These guys are building a scratch-built diorama of the Battle of Trafalgar in 1:150 scale. It's absolutely amazing. All built "Navy Board" style, with full framing and the rest. If you have any interest in modeling, these sites are worth checking out. They've been at it for three years. It looks like they've been at it for three lifetimes! Simply incredible.
